Hurricane Helene Devastates Southeastern United States
Hurricane Helene has wreaked havoc across the Southeastern United States, becoming one of the deadliest storms in modern history. Affected areas, particularly in Florida and North Carolina, are grappling with extensive destruction and the daunting task of recovery. Many Florida communities, already beleaguered by three hurricanes in just 13 months, are now confronting the grim reality of homes lost and the lack of insurance to aid in rebuilding. Satellite images depict the catastrophic extent of the damage, illustrating a 400-mile path of devastation. Local residents share harrowing experiences, including near-death escapes and the emotional toll of losing everything they owned. With countless homes damaged or destroyed, community efforts are underway to support recovery, though the road ahead remains long and uncertain. As cleanup continues, the impact of Helene is painfully clear—entire neighborhoods lie in ruins, and the future feels bleak for many who have lost their livelihoods and homes.
